Chapter 14: Qi Gui: I finally found where my heart belongs, maybe?
"Gui Gui, are you willing to be my disciple? Whether you are a powerful being or a mortal, whether you are cultivating immortals or demons, I will accompany you forever."
"I am willing."
The whole place was silent. All the disciples looked confused and couldn't understand what was going on. Why could Luo Yiyi successfully persuade Qi Gui, who had a firm faith in Taoism, to rebel with just one sentence?
Not to mention them, even the person involved, Qi Gui, felt overwhelming regret after he woke up from his moved state. He himself didn't know if he was under some kind of illusion or witchcraft, and he agreed to it in a daze?
It must be said that the meaning of "stay together forever" in Luo Yiyi's words hit the softest spot in Qi Gui's heart. He really longed for human warmth, so much so that he would rather go against the path in his heart and want to keep it and never let it go.
Only Nangong Xue kindly reminded him: "Are you really willing? You should know that once you agree, the relationship between you and my master will be severed and there will be no possibility of it ever again."
"I……"
Qi Gui wanted to say that he was unwilling, but he saw Luo Yiyi let go of his hand, lowered her head and took something out of the storage bag. His attention was attracted to it, and he even forgot to express his objection.
What Luo Yiyi took out was actually a candied haws. The only remaining bright red fruit wrapped in golden sugar coating was strung on a thin bamboo stick and handed to Qi Gui.
"Gui Gui, you can't go back on your word. This is my favorite candied haws. I can't bear to eat the last one. Now I give it to you. After you eat it, you must be my apprentice and don't think of anyone else as your master."
Qi Gui was moved when he saw the candied haws. The thing he once longed for was now given to him with great treasure. Although he was no longer at the age to eat candied haws, to him, the thought contained in this candied haws was more important than anything else.
Nangong Xue noticed that Qi Gui was reaching out to take the candied haws like a madman again, and was about to remind him but was stopped by Ding Yurou who grabbed his arm.
"Xue'er, stop trying to stop me. Don't you realize that this is the fate of Qi Gui?"
"But this is not normal. According to his aspirations, he should have taken the path of sword cultivation. How could he die here? And for such a ridiculous reason? Yu Rou, I don't agree!"
Ding Yurou knew that Nangong Xue had always been an upright person and would occasionally get stuck in a rut, but as a good friend she had to stop her.
"Xue'er, only each person knows the path he wants to take. Outsiders have no right to comment on right and wrong. It is enough that you have reminded Qi Gui. It is his own business to make the choice, and he will naturally bear the corresponding consequences. But how can you say whether it is a blessing or a curse?"
Nangong Xue was sometimes too straightforward, but she was not stupid, and she quickly realized that she had done something wrong. This realization made her feel confused, why was she so anxious about Qi Gui's choice just now? Obviously, she was not an enthusiastic person, and she had nothing to do with Qi Gui.
While Nangong Xue was pondering the reason for her abnormality, Qi Gui took the candied haws for some unknown reason.
After waiting for a while, seeing that Qi Gui was just staring at the candied haws stupidly and had no intention of eating it at all, Luo Yiyi was very worried that he would regret it, so she tiptoed to grab his hand holding the bamboo stick, and pushed it towards his mouth desperately, constantly encouraging him.
"Guigui, eat it, eat it quickly. The candied haws are delicious. If you don't eat them, they will go bad. If they go bad, they will be thrown away. So eat them quickly, otherwise the candied haws will cry."
Qi Gui's mind had been blank since just now, and he subconsciously did what Luo Yiyi said. He lowered his head, took a bite of the shiny candied haws, and chewed it carefully.
The sweet and sour taste is very novel, and it leaves a refreshing taste in your mouth after swallowing it. It is suitable for all ages, and it is no wonder that children like it very much.
When Luo Yiyi saw that he finally swallowed a mouthful, the heavy stone in her heart was completely relieved. After all, she thought that if Qi Gui ate the thing she gave him, he would definitely follow her.
"Is it tasty?"
I don’t know if it’s because he has never had sweets before, but Qi Gui is not used to the sweetness of candied haws. I don’t think they are delicious, but this candied haws makes up for the regret in his heart, which is of great significance.
"good to eat!"
"That's great~"
Seeing the sweet smile on Luo Yiyi's face, Qi Gui felt that the sweet feeling in his mouth seemed to become even stronger.
What he didn't know was that at this moment, the corners of his mouth curled up slightly, and for the first time, an innocent smile belonging to a teenager appeared on his face.
Behind them, the disciples all had complicated expressions. If one were to describe it in one sentence, it would be: the dog food was blocking their throats, making them feel aggrieved! It was annoying!
As if he had seen the disciples' rising resentment, the master kindly gave them a reminder.
"Qi Gui, now that you have made your decision, why don't you go meet your master?"
Hiding the empty bamboo stick inside his robe, Qi Gui raised his head, looked at Xuanyuan Zhan deeply with a farewell to the past, then resolutely looked away, knelt straight down in front of Luo Yiyi, folded his palms up and down to his forehead, bent down and bowed.
"Disciple Qi Gui, I pay my respects to the Master!"
Thinking that the master would probably say a few words of expectation to the apprentice when becoming his disciple, Luo Yiyi said sincerely with full selfishness.
"Qi Gui, as my only disciple, I hope you can live without fear of worldly gazes (not afraid of becoming a demon) and follow your heart (become a demon if you want). No matter what choice you make, I will always be by your side to support you (help you become the most awesome demon king)."
Unfortunately, Qi Gui couldn't hear Luo Yiyi's inner voice, so all he thought about was his ugly appearance, his tortuous life experience, and his identity as a part immortal and part demon, but his little master said that she didn't mind these things.
He was finally no longer alone in this vast world. From then on, he had someone he could care about, and wherever the person he cared about was, that was his home.
"Disciple, please obey Master's teachings!"
He made a vow in his heart to live up to his master's wishes in this life.
Afterwards, the head of the sect made a summary speech, announcing that the Tianyan Sect competition had officially come to an end. Then everyone went back to their own homes and mothers.
With mixed feelings, Yuan Fei came to Luo Yiyi.
"Yiyi, it turns out you had this plan in mind. I misunderstood you. I'm sorry."
Luo Yiyi, who was showing off to Qi Gui the treasures of Tianlu Peak, looked at him in surprise when she heard his words, not understanding what he meant.
Qi Gui didn't know Yuan Fei, he only knew that he replaced him as Xuanyuan Zhan's personal disciple. But strangely, he didn't hate Yuan Fei, but was curious about him. He wanted to know how he did it, and also wanted to know his relationship with Luo Yiyi.
Similarly, Yuan Fei was also very curious about Qi Gui. He didn't know why Luo Yiyi cared about him so much, but he didn't have much time. Deacon Huang would come to see him soon, so he could only suppress his doubts and bow solemnly to Qi Gui.
"Uncle Master Qi, from now on, I will leave my uncle-master in your care."
Qi Gui, who became Luo Yiyi's apprentice, had the same seniority as the head and the peak master, so he naturally became Yuan Fei's uncle. This was very normal in the Tianyan Sect, which attached great importance to etiquette and rules, so even if Qi Gui found it awkward, he would not try to change the way others called him.
"I will definitely take good care of Master."
After exchanging glances, the two nodded at the same time. Glancing at Deacon Huang who was waiting not far away, Yuan Fei bowed and said goodbye to the two of them.
"Feifei!"
The familiar call made Yuan Fei's back freeze. Turning around, Luo Yiyi's expression pretending to be a little adult was still adorable.
"Remember to listen to your master and practice well!"
Yuan Fei opened his eyes wide as a memory suddenly appeared in his mind. That was what he said when he was just assigned to Luo Yiyi and sent her to school for the first time.
"Uncle Master, remember to listen to the Master and study hard."
It was not until then that he realized that the days and nights he had spent taking care of Luo Yiyi over the past three years had already taken root in his heart, and it would be in vain even if he was reluctant to let her go.
"Follow the teachings of my great-grandmaster!"
